美国VPS容器化面试高频问题解析
文章分类:行业新闻 /
创建时间:2025-12-02
在数字化转型加速的今天,容器化技术因高效部署和灵活扩展的特性,成为企业技术架构的核心组件。而美国VPS凭借优质的网络带宽与稳定的物理资源,逐渐成为容器化部署的热门选择。技术岗位面试中,围绕美国VPS环境下容器化的问题频繁出现,掌握这些问题的解答逻辑,对通过面试至关重要。
容器化基础概念:核心价值与美区VPS适配性
面试官常问:“如何用通俗语言解释容器化?它在美国VPS环境中有哪些独特优势?”
容器化可理解为“应用程序的独立打包技术”——将应用代码、运行库、配置文件等依赖项封装成标准容器,如同“应用程序的集装箱”,确保在不同环境中“开箱即用”。在美国VPS环境下,这种技术的适配性尤为突出:一方面,美国VPS通常具备较高的网络带宽(如常见的1Gbps端口)和低延迟特性,能充分发挥容器轻量、快速启动的优势;另一方面,容器的资源隔离性(每个容器独立占用CPU、内存)可避免多应用部署时的资源争抢,而美国VPS的物理机级资源分配(无超售架构)进一步保障了容器性能的稳定性。某跨境电商团队曾反馈,在美区VPS上使用容器化部署多套营销系统后,单容器响应速度提升25%,资源利用率从40%跃升至70%。
容器编排工具:K8s与Compose的美区场景选择
“美国VPS环境中,Kubernetes(K8s)和Docker Compose的适用场景有何差异?”是考察技术落地能力的典型问题。
K8s作为开源容器编排系统,主打大规模集群管理,支持自动化扩缩容、服务发现、负载均衡等高级功能。在美区VPS上,若部署的容器数量超过10个(如微服务架构的电商平台),K8s能根据VPS的实时网络质量(如美国到亚太的延迟数据)和资源使用率(CPU/内存占用),智能调度容器到最优节点,避免因网络波动导致的服务中断。某SaaS企业曾用K8s管理美区VPS上的20个容器,系统故障恢复时间从30分钟缩短至5分钟。
Docker Compose则是轻量级工具,通过YAML文件定义多容器应用,适合小型项目(如5个以内的测试环境或初创企业的初期业务)。在美区VPS中,若业务规模较小且需要快速迭代(如内部管理系统),Compose的“一键部署”特性可节省70%的配置时间,降低技术门槛。
网络配置:美区VPS与容器的通信保障
“如何配置美国VPS与容器的网络,确保内外通信流畅?”需结合实操经验回答。
首先,VPS基础网络需打通:检查防火墙规则(如iptables或云厂商安全组),开放容器常用端口(如80/443用于HTTP服务,5432用于PostgreSQL)。其次,根据业务需求选择容器网络模式:桥接模式(默认)下,容器拥有独立IP,适合需要外部访问的服务(如官网);主机模式下,容器共享VPS的网络栈,减少网络转发延迟,适合对性能敏感的内部服务(如缓存数据库Redis)。某金融科技公司曾在美区VPS上为交易系统容器采用主机模式,API响应时间从80ms降至50ms。若需多容器对外提供服务,可搭配Nginx或HAProxy作为负载均衡器,根据VPS的带宽使用情况动态分配流量,避免单点压力过大。
容器安全:美区VPS环境的防护要点
“美国VPS上部署容器时,如何防范常见安全风险?”需覆盖镜像、运行、网络三个层面。
镜像安全是基础:优先使用官方镜像(如Docker Hub的nginx:alpine),避免下载无维护记录的第三方镜像(曾有案例因使用未验证镜像导致恶意代码植入)。定期用Trivy等工具扫描镜像漏洞,及时更新至安全版本。运行时防护需限制容器权限,禁用root用户(可通过--user参数指定普通用户),并利用cgroups控制容器资源上限(如限制CPU使用不超过2核),防止单个容器抢占VPS资源影响其他服务。网络层面,启用容器间的网络策略(如K8s的NetworkPolicy),仅允许必要的端口通信(如数据库容器仅开放给应用容器访问),同时通过VPS的流量监控工具(如iftop)实时监测异常网络行为。
掌握美国VPS环境下的容器化技术要点,不仅能帮助你在面试中精准回答问题,更能为实际项目中的容器部署和管理提供扎实的技术支撑。从基础概念到安全实践,每一个环节的深入理解,都是技术能力的重要体现。
工信部备案:粤ICP备18132883号-2